Overview

The Seres SF5 was initially unveiled as a

in 2018 alongside the SF7, however, this was revised to the production SF5 in early 2019. The SF5 has a 17-inch screen on the center console, and is one of the first vehicles to ever utilize the Ali OS 2.0 infotainment system.
The tire dimensions of the SF5 are 255/45 R20 and 255/40 R21. The 2WD model is powered by one motor and the AWD model is powered by two motors with the motor capable of producing a maximum of . The range extended versions is equipped with a ''SFG15TR'' 1.5-litre engine producing as the range extender with the combined fuel consumption of and for the 2WD and AWD models.
Mass production version has a price range from 278,000 to 458,000 yuan.
Aito M5
In December 2021 an extensively modified version of the SF5 was presented as the AITO M5. It was developed in cooperation with
Huawei

. The model was sold under a new brand called AITO, which stands for “Adding Intelligence to Auto”.
